Can Dog Ticks Bite Humans. Most tick bites are painless and cause only minor signs and symptoms such as a change in skin color swelling or a sore on the skin. People can not catch Lyme disease or Rocky Mountain spotted fever from infected dogs but the same ticks that bite dogs can cause these illnesses and others if they bite humans. The ticks are known to be highly attracted to four-legged pets. Ticks are common in the United States.
